Albert Edward Hutt, Air Engineer, Born January 30,1901 In Ontario. He Served As Aircraft Mechanic With Rfc In 1917 - 1918 In Canada And Usa. He Obtained Ist Air Engineer'S Licence On November 9, 1921 At Camp Borden With Canadian Air Board And Was With Canadian Air Force At High River, Ab, Until 1923. He Was With The Opas At Sudbury, Chapleau And Sault Ste Marie From 1924 To 1928. He Joined Wca. In 1928 And Became Engine Shop Foreman And Assistant Maintance Superintendent. He Worked Continuously At Brandon Avenue. In February, 1940 He Received His 10 Year Service Pin When He Was Assistant Maintenance Manager In Winnipeg. In March, 1941 He Was Superintendent Of Engine Overhaul Depot At Stevenson Field. In February, 1942 He Was Appointed Maintenance Supertendent Of Central District Cpal. In May, 1942 He Transferred To Vancouver. He Retired From Position Of Director Of Maintenance And Engineering For Cpa In 1966 In Vancouver |
